Indonesia is home to a vibrant shopping culture, with numerous malls offering diverse experiences. From luxurious brands to local boutiques, these malls have become popular destinations for shopping, dining, and entertainment. Let’s look at the top 10 most interesting malls in the shopping landscape of the country.
Pacific Place Mall is a high-end shopping destination in Jakarta, known for its luxury brands and upscale atmosphere. With its elegant architecture and premium selection of fashion, accessories, and lifestyle stores, it caters to the city’s affluent shoppers.
Plaza Indonesia is a prestigious mall that showcases a fusion of local and international luxury brands. Its sophisticated design, gourmet dining options, and exclusive events make it a favored destination for fashion enthusiasts and connoisseurs of refined experiences.
With its vast retail space and diverse range of stores, Grand Indonesia is one of the largest malls in Jakarta. It offers extensive local and international brands and entertainment options such as cinemas and a dedicated children’s play area.

Senayan City is a premium shopping complex that caters to Jakarta’s fashion-forward crowd. Known for its chic interior design and iconic “Crystal Bridge” connecting two towers, it offers a curated selection of high-end fashion, beauty, and lifestyle brands.
Tunjungan Plaza is the largest mall in Surabaya and one of the biggest in Southeast Asia. Its expansive retail space features a mix of local and international brands, entertainment facilities, and a diverse culinary scene, providing a comprehensive shopping experience.
Kota Kasablanka stands out for its unique architectural design, which combines modernity with elements inspired by Moroccan aesthetics. It offers a wide range of retail and entertainment options, including a multiplex cinema, making it a popular destination for families and urbanites.

Gandaria City is a lifestyle and entertainment hub that offers a diverse array of retail and dining experiences. Its trendy fashion boutiques, recreational facilities, and regular events attract a young and fashionable crowd.
Lippo Mall Kemang is a community-oriented mall known for its convenient location and comprehensive range of stores. It caters to the needs of residents in the Kemang area, offering a mix of retail, grocery, and entertainment options.

Ciputra World Surabaya is an iconic mall featuring contemporary architecture and diverse international brands. Its sophisticated ambiance, culinary delights, and luxurious amenities make it a popular destination for discerning shoppers.
Trans Studio Mall Makassar is part of a larger entertainment complex and offers a unique shopping experience with its combination of retail outlets, amusement park, and indoor theme park. It is a popular destination for families and thrill-seekers.
